I'm a 30-year-old SDE-2 looking to shift my career towards data and machine learning. I’ve started as an Android Engineer and also have experience with React and Node.js. However, I no longer find these areas satisfying. Now, I understand the importance of staying consistent within a domain. For the next decade, I want to focus on a technology that will remain relevant for the next twenty years, without being affected by frequent framework changes.
I've noticed that people around 25 years old are able to build impressive projects thanks to good courses and tutorials. Although they make mistakes, it seems likely that within the next two or three years, they will have overcome these challenges. I find data and machine learning more rewarding because they involve answering meaningful questions. Recently, there was an internal opening in my company for a data and ML role, but I didn’t apply because I clearly lacked the necessary skills. However, I believe it’s time to switch and commit to this new direction. Any advice on making this transition smoothly and choosing the right path would be greatly appreciated.